I have an access database which keeps market transactions.

"description" - what type of transaction is it, e.g. 'Sales'

"Type" - What the name of the item is, e.g. 'Co-Processor', 'hea
sink'

"Quantity" - how many items sold per transaction

I'd like to get a list of all types of items which have 'Sales' in te
description, and how many items per type.

So 'Co-Processor' only shows up in one row, and in the cell next to i
is the total quantity for all the 'Co-Processor' types in th
transaction database, and 'heat sink' shows up in the next row with it
total items, and so on.

What's the easiest way to do this?

It sounds like a pivot table would be a good start.

Data=Pivot Table Report and Chart

follow the wizard. Make sure you go into layout on the last screen and
layout out your data using the field buttons.
